Concerning zeal, persecuting the church; touching the righteousness which is in the law, blameless.

Bible References

Zeal

Acts 21:20
And they on hearing it glorified God; and said to him, Thou seest, brother, how many thousands of believers there are among the Jews, and they are all zealots for the Law.
Romans 10:2
For I bear them witness that they have a zeal for God, but not according to knowledge.
Galatians 1:13
For ye have heard of my conduct formerly in Judaism; that beyond measure I persecuted the church of God, and was destroying it,

Persecuting

Acts 8:3
But Saul ravaged the church, entering house after house, and dragging both men and women, committed them to prison.
Acts 9:1
But Saul, yet breathing out threatening and slaughter against the disciples of the Lord, went to the high priest,
Acts 22:3
I am indeed a Jew, born in Tarsus of Cilicia, hut brought up in this city, taught at the feet of Gamaliel in the strictness of the Law of our fathers, being zealous for God, as ye all are this day.
Acts 26:9
I indeed thought with myself that I ought to do many things in opposition to the name of Jesus the Nazarene.
1 Corinthians 15:9
For I am the least of the apostles, one not worthy to be called an apostle, because I persecuted the church of God.
1 Timothy 1:13
though formerly I was a blasphemer, and a persecutor, and a doer of outrage; but I obtained mercy, because I did it ignorantly, in unbelief;
